The agency's primary affiliation is with Pro Travel Network. This is a crucial piece of information for any potential customer to understand. Pro Travel Network functions as a host agency, providing back-end support, booking tools, and supplier relationships to a network of independent agents. For the client, this can be advantageous. An agent connected to a large network like this gains access to a wide array of vacation packages, cruise deals, and industry resources that might otherwise be out of reach for a solo operator. This structure allows J Gilliam Destinations to offer a comprehensive range of travel products, from flights and hotels to complex custom itineraries and all-inclusive resorts. However, it's worth noting that some industry resources classify Pro Travel Network as having a multi-level marketing (MLM) component, which involves agents recruiting other agents. This doesn't directly impact the booking process for a customer, but it does mean the agent is an independent business owner whose success is entirely dependent on their own efforts and expertise, rather than a corporate brand standard.

Working with an independent agent like J Gilliam Destinations offers a fundamentally different experience than booking through a major online travel agency or a large, branded firm. Here’s a breakdown of the potential pros and cons.
Potential Advantages:
- Personalized Attention: The core appeal of such an agency is the promise of highly personalized service. Clients work directly with one individual who handles every aspect of their booking. This can be ideal for planning complex trips, such as destination weddings, honeymoon packages, or large group travel arrangements, where a single point of contact is invaluable.
- Access to Network Deals: Through Pro Travel Network, the agent can access a wide inventory of travel products and potentially secure deals or amenities not available to the general public. This network provides the agent with the leverage of a larger organization.
- Flexibility: The generous operating hours indicate a willingness to work around client schedules, a level of flexibility often missing in more corporate environments.
Points for Consideration:
- Agent-Dependent Quality: Since the agent is an independent business owner, the quality of your experience rests entirely on their individual professionalism, knowledge, and dedication. There is no corporate oversight or standardized training to guarantee a certain level of service.
- Lack of Specialization Information: The generic website gives no indication of whether the agent specializes in a particular type of travel. It is unclear if their expertise lies in luxury travel, budget adventures, specific geographic regions, or certain types of cruises. Clients will need to conduct a thorough initial consultation to determine if the agent is a good fit for their specific needs.
- High Degree of Trust Required: Due to the absence of reviews and a minimal online presence, a customer must place a significant amount of trust in the agent from the very beginning. This can be a hurdle for many, especially when planning expensive or once-in-a-lifetime trips.
